Output 6e11738cc1685c5ea7768abd2267502524181a453354051b43feb83895de079c:1

value
1224598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7a8bb5e622fa4f3bc65506de35878fc1088292 OP_EQUAL
address
3HWHdMiaDZdG24Kj1QurqJAonJ3g7fu3zf
transaction
6e11738cc1685c5ea7768abd2267502524181a453354051b43feb83895de079c
confirmations
294930
spent
true